Output 51ec7fe1bdfb31f3f9bbfff2bca5fb116d139114db6679268836e429fd1f5716:0

value
13523498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d78e623465fa2cb0b3f32776054f30c48d71c6 OP_EQUAL
address
3MGzkhfDXZNQfSMBwXjLE4Mio9kLmxkdqb
transaction
51ec7fe1bdfb31f3f9bbfff2bca5fb116d139114db6679268836e429fd1f5716
spent
true